Ciudad Colonial
Discover the historic heart of Santo Domingo, where cobblestone streets like Calle Las Damas lead to landmarks such as Alcázar de Colón and Catedral de Santa María la Menor. Stroll along pedestrian-only Calle del Conde, and enjoy local shops and restaurants near Plaza de España.
